Melasti Beach is located along the southern coast of Bali and marks the island’s southernmost point. With its white sand, crystal-clear water, and dramatic limestone cliffs, it is a true gem. It is a lesser-known beach, allowing you to easily avoid large crowds.
The entrance to the beach is nothing short of impressive. Once you have paid the entrance fee (€1.29 for a family of four), you drive down a wide road through the stunning cliffs to reach the beach.
The wide beach stretches for several kilometers and features a number of beach clubs with beautiful pools, including Tropical Temptation and White Rock. We chose the first one since there is no mandatory minimum spending on food and drinks.
The beach club offers multiple pools, a DJ, and a foam cannon—guaranteed fun! On top of that, you can enjoy the stunning view of the beach.
